How Much Does the Experience Cost?
Admission Prices:
– Adults: $34.99
– Children (4-12): $24.99
– Children (3 and under): Free
– Seniors (62+): $32.99
– Military Personnel: 10% discount
When Should You Plan Your Visit?
Operating Hours:
– Open daily from 9 AM to 6 PM
– Peak season: Mid-April to Mid-October
– Special shows vary by season

Location and Accessibility
Address: 4604 Hwy 17 S, North Myrtle Beach, SC 29582
– Adjacent to House of Blues
– Convenient parking
– Wheelchair accessible
